Что означают проверочные окружения

Тестовые инфраструктуры образуют как самостоятельные пространства, в каких тестируется функционирование программного софта до этого продукта применения при рабочей платформе. Они настраиваются ради того, дабы находить сбои, оценивать работу программы и валидировать стабильность правок при отсутствии угрозы для стабильной эксплуатации продукта. Подобные окружения имитируют параметры рабочей эксплуатации, при этом совсем не Гет Икс воздействуют по пользователей а также основные процессы.

При процессе программирования проверочные инфраструктуры имеют важную роль. Дополнительные источники, аналогичные вроде гет икс официальный сайт, дают возможность выяснить устройство инфраструктур плюс принципы этих сред использования. Ключевое место принадлежит точности имитации условий, стабильности работы а также возможности контролируемого проверки различных вариантов.

Роль испытательных инфраструктур

Главная задача испытательной среды — предоставить контролируемое окружение для тестирования правок. Каждая новая опция, исправление дефекта либо изменение системы на старте валидируется в отдельном контуре. Данное помогает выявить ошибки раньше момента, как такие ошибки воздействуют на основную платформу.

Проверочные среды тоже используются ради проверки согласованности. Программа имеет возможность обмениваться по системами информации, сторонними сервисами а также внутренними элементами. При испытательной инфраструктуре получается убедиться, если все элементы функционируют Get X правильно вместе.

Кроме того отдельной целью является оценка производительности. При проверочном пространстве создается активность, чтобы понять, каким образом система показывает работу в случае большом объеме действий. Данное позволяет выявить слабые места а также предварительно настроиться к повышению использования.

Типы тестовых инфраструктур

Имеется несколько типов испытательных инфраструктур. Программирование как правило стартует во персональной среде, в которой разработчик валидирует частные обновления. Эта среда характеризуется высокой гибкостью а также помогает быстро делать корректировки.

Другим уровнем выступает интеграционная инфраструктура. Здесь оценивается связь разных модулей сервиса. Основная функция — проверить, что элементы стабильно обмениваются сведениями и совсем не вызывают ошибок.

Staging-среда наиболее приближена под боевой. В этой среде валидируется финальная сборка продукта раньше релизом. Это помогает измерить работу платформы при условиях, похожих под рабочим.

Кроме того имеет возможность задействоваться специальная среда с целью стрессового проверки. В данном контуре имитируется высокая интенсивность, для того чтобы проверить надежность платформы а также данной системы возможность выполнять крупное количество запросов.

Организация испытательной среды

Тестовая среда включает несколько элементов. Базу формирует узел или набор машин, в каких запускается программа. Дополнительно используются системы сведений, решения хранения и сетевые Гет Икс модули.

Параметры окружения должна соответствовать реальным настройкам. Такое затрагивает редакций прикладного софта, настроек машин а также схемы данных. Чем детальнее среда имитирует рабочую платформу, настолько точнее выводы валидации.

Также имеют возможность задействоваться синтетические сведения. Эти наборы моделируют фактические данные, однако никак не содержат личной сведений. Такие наборы дают возможность оценить схему действия приложения вне риска утечки информации.

Контроль данными при испытательной среде

Работа по сведениями предполагает специального метода. Во тестовой среде применяются варианты а также отдельно созданные массивы Get X информации. Такое позволяет повторять различные сценарии плюс валидировать поведение системы при многообразных условиях.

Следует контролировать свежесть данных. Если данные потеряла актуальность, выводы валидации могут оказаться ошибочными. Поэтому сведения периодически обновляются либо генерируются с нуля.

Дополнительно следует оценивать безопасность. Тестовые сведения совсем не должны включать фактическую личную информацию. Ради данного задействуются способы обезличивания плюс GetX формирования искусственных данных.

Механизация проверочных инфраструктур

Современные системы программирования регулярно применяют автообработку. Испытательные среды имеют возможность разворачиваться а также настраиваться программно. Такое дает возможность быстро разворачивать контур с целью валидации обновлений.

Механизация предполагает конфигурацию узлов, подключение компонентов и загрузку данных. Такой метод сокращает частоту сбоев плюс ускоряет цикл тестирования.

Кроме того автоматизируется очистка плюс актуализация инфраструктуры. После окончания проверки контур способно стать сброшено а также создано заново. Это сохраняет стабильность плюс исключает сбор сбоев Гет Икс.

Соотношение с CI/CD циклами

Проверочные инфраструктуры напрямую связаны через CI/CD. При любом коммите программы самостоятельно стартуют пайплайны, которые используют проверочные среды ради проверки. Это позволяет оперативно выявлять ошибки плюс предотвращать этих ошибок распространение.

Отдельный шаг CI/CD способен использовать отдельную область. Например, межкомпонентные проверки запускаются во конкретной среде, и заключительная оценка — в отдельной. Такой метод усиливает надежность системы.

Самостоятельное обращение с тестовыми инфраструктурами создает механизм создания гораздо понятным. Любые изменения проходят стандартную цепочку тестов.

Контроль корректности

Контроль качества становится важной функцией испытательных инфраструктур. Во них запускаются различные виды тестирования: функциональное, связующее, стрессовое и контрольное. Отдельный формат проверки проверяет конкретный элемент работы сервиса.

Итоги тестирования записываются а также оцениваются. Если обнаружены сбои, правки возвращаются к исправление. Это снижает переход ошибок GetX во продуктовую область.

Регулярное тестирование помогает сохранять надежность платформы. Даже ограниченные изменения способны повлиять на функционирование приложения, потому проверка осуществляется постоянно.

Распространенные ошибки в процессе применении проверочных окружений

Первой в числе частых проблем выступает расхождение окружения реальным настройкам. В случае если настройка не совпадает, выводы валидации могут оказаться неточными. Такое приводит в сбоям после запуска.

Также одной проблемой выступает использование устаревших данных. В этом случае проверка никак не демонстрирует Гет Икс реальную обстановку, плюс ошибки имеют возможность сохраниться невыявленными.

Кроме того возникает ограниченная самостоятельность. Когда испытательная среда объединена по рабочей системой, существует вероятность влияния при рабочие данные. Это способно привести к опасным инцидентам.

Защита испытательных инфраструктур

Проверочные инфраструктуры обязаны быть закрыты так же образом, подобно и боевые инфраструктуры. Они имеют возможность содержать служебную информацию про структуре сервиса плюс данного приложения схеме. Следовательно вход Get X в таким окружениям может быть закрыт.

Применяются способы проверки входа, шифрования плюс мониторинга. Такое позволяет исключить несанкционированное использование среды.

Кроме того необходимо наблюдать за поддержкой цифрового софта. Устаревшие элементы имеют возможность содержать риски, что способны быть задействованы злоумышленниками GetX.

Мониторинг тестовых инфраструктур

Мониторинг позволяет отслеживать работу проверочной инфраструктуры. Данный механизм демонстрирует использование мощностей, сбои и эффективность. Это помогает находить сбои совсем не лишь при программе, однако плюс в самой инфраструктуре.

Периодическое наблюдение помогает сохранять надежность окружения. Когда средства заканчиваются либо возникают неполадки, это способно повлиять на результаты тестирования.

Мониторинг дополнительно помогает оптимизировать использование мощностей. Такое крайне существенно в случае работе по несколькими инфраструктурами параллельно.

Расширенные аспекты проверочных инфраструктур

Одним из в числе значимых направлений выступает управление версиями среды. Разные этапы программирования способны требовать разных конфигураций а также условий. Поэтому Get X важно записывать условия окружения плюс контролировать обновления. Такое дает возможность создавать настройки валидации а также избегать несовпадений внутри результатами.

Кроме того задействуется принцип краткосрочных инфраструктур. Для любой проверки либо проверки создается отдельная область, которая очищается затем завершения проверки. Такое позволяет тестировать изменения независимо плюс снижает риск конфликтов внутри отдельными версиями приложения.

Кроме того одним аспектом является связь с средствами программирования. Испытательные среды имеют возможность автоматически GetX интегрироваться к системам учета версий, CI/CD процессам и средствам мониторинга. Такое создает цикл тестирования более оперативным а также контролируемым.

Настройка применения испытательных инфраструктур

С целью стабильной поддержки необходимо оптимизировать мощности. Создание и поддержка среды требует серверных мощностей, следовательно необходимо проверять их занятость. Самостоятельное остановка ненужных окружений дает возможность Гет Икс уменьшить расход ресурсов.

Оптимизация тоже охватывает организацию процессов. Не все валидации обязаны выполняться в единой среде. Распределение задач среди окружениями повышает скорость валидацию и уменьшает время задержки.

Периодический контроль использования тестовых окружений позволяет находить проблемные участки. Если операции работают медленно либо постоянно возникают сбои, конфигурации нужно пересматривать. Такое формирует платформу более стабильной и быстрой Get X.

Прикладное значение испытательных окружений

Испытательные окружения применяются во разных шагах разработки. Эти окружения позволяют выявлять ошибки, тестировать обновления плюс улучшать надежность сервиса. Вне подобных сред риск ошибок при продуктовой инфраструктуре сильно возрастает.

Правильно выстроенные испытательные окружения делают механизм разработки гораздо понятным. Отдельное обновление выполняет валидацию, это снижает частоту неожиданных сбоев.

Осознание основ функционирования тестовых сред дает возможность глубже разбираться в нынешних технологиях программирования. Это GetX предоставляет картину насчет том, как формируются, валидируются плюс публикуются онлайн решения.

Leave a Reply

Your email address will not be published. Required fields are marked *